The Front Desk Associate is the face of AvantStay and our boots on the ground at our market office location. This is one of the most versatile roles at the company and perfect for anyone who loves being on the go and finds fulfillment in serving our guests. The Front Desk Associate’s primary responsibility will be facilitating in person guest check-ins. In addition they will be responsible for managing all aspects of the office from handling deliveries, organizing supplies, documenting par levels of linens/supplies in storage, and at times providing support to the local teams and vendors with market operations. The ideal Front Desk Associate is detail oriented and thrives on problem-solving issues. This person will primarily work onsite at the office to ensure guest check ins are flawless, while at times performing inspections or team support during not peak arrival days.
Job Responsibility:
Conduct live check-ins for our arriving guests. You are often the first impression and face of the company
Receive, organize and stock deliveries of housekeeping and operational supplies
Lift, move, unpack and do the more “unglamorous” sides of organization of the office and storeroom
Guide guests through the AvantStay experience, ensuring they have an amazing first impression
Stay in constant communication with the field team with updates on guest’s arrivals and requests
Utilize our technology to release check in instructions and close out “Live Check-In” cases in Salesforce
Assist with inventory duties such as preparing items for the field team, receiving deliveries, and tracking linen/consumables use
Maintain and organize gathering spaces including office, and surrounding area
